Understanding the Core of Korean Cuisine

Korean food is more than just a collection of individual dishes; it is a cultural experience. Some essential dishes represent the heart of Korean gastronomy:

The Kimchi Revolution

Kimchi is a staple, a fermented vegetable dish, most commonly made from napa cabbage and seasoned with chili powder, garlic, ginger, and other spices. Kimchi is an amazing probiotic food, offering multiple health benefits. The variety of kimchi includes the iconic baechu kimchi (made with napa cabbage), along with many other regional variations and different ingredients.

Bulgogi Brilliance

Bulgogi, marinated and grilled thinly sliced beef, exemplifies Korean culinary finesse. The sweet and savory marinade, often incorporating soy sauce, sesame oil, garlic, and sugar, tenderizes the beef while infusing it with an irresistible flavor. It is a beloved dish.

The Colorful Harmony of Bibimbap

Bibimbap, meaning “mixed rice”, is a visual and culinary masterpiece. This dish consists of a bed of rice topped with an assortment of colorful vegetables (like carrots, spinach, and bean sprouts), seasoned meat, a fried egg, and a generous dollop of gochujang.

Noodle Nirvana

Japchae, glass noodles with vegetables and meat, is another popular dish. The noodles, made from sweet potato starch, are stir-fried with a colorful array of vegetables and often a protein, providing a delicious balance of textures and flavors.

Korean BBQ: A Social Feast

Korean BBQ, as mentioned earlier, is a social dining experience where diners grill marinated meats at their tables. This interactive experience provides a fun and engaging way to share a meal with friends and family.

Spicy Rice Cakes

Tteokbokki (spicy rice cakes) are chewy rice cakes simmered in a fiery red gochujang-based sauce. It is a much-loved street food and comfort food favorite.

Tips for Navigating the Korean Dining Experience

Navigating a Korean restaurant can be an enjoyable experience. Here are a few pointers:

Embracing the Korean Culture

Korean food encourages sharing dishes. Ordering multiple dishes and sharing them with your dining companions is common. This encourages trying a variety of flavors.

Chopstick Mastery

Learning how to use chopsticks properly will enhance your dining experience. Practice makes perfect, and most restaurants offer helpful instructions.

Understanding the Menu

Many restaurants offer pictures to help clarify the food on offer. The menus are also often in Korean and English. Do not be afraid to ask questions!

Dietary Considerations

Many Korean restaurants offer vegetarian and vegan options. Communicate any dietary restrictions to your server. Korean food may be spicy, so communicate your spice tolerance level to your server.
